    @nancyharman4795 6 месяцев назад +1

    For further variety, for half of your total number of blocks, you could flip all of the templates over (with the letters facing down against the fabric) before cutting. (Can always put a masking tape spot with the appropriate letter on the reverse side to stay organized). Then, after sewing all the mirror-reverse blocks, you'd have 8 different shape orientation layouts instead of the original 4 (each orientation achieved by rotating the block 90 degrees, 180, 270, etc). A truly glorious mix! Loved this video! Thanks for so many tips!!! 🥰

    @winkielaroo 7 месяцев назад +3

    That's crazy gorgeous! I actually prefer the version without sashing; it's just so exuberantly chaotic, but then I do like color chaos 😉. Thank you for sharing your whole process. A couple observations: First, the crosswise grain is called weft, not waft. And second, wavy borders will make life very difficult for your longarmer 😢, so unless you'll be tying your quilt, it really is best to take the necessary steps (touched on in this video) to get your quilt borders on so they will lay flat, quilt police or no.
